I’m spending most of today at home to recover from last night, so I’m wearing a cozy sweater and my favourite pair of jeans. These Topman Stretch Skinny jeans are the most worn jeans in my closet. Although they were super inexpensive at just $50, I like them because they have 2% elastane which makes such a huge difference in comfort. Also, it helps that they have a tapered leg opening, allowing me to wear both shoes and boots with them.
